Voidress is strong enough for S tier. I had been using it 5th slot for the past few seasons for the deadweight removal, reliable piercing at a good speed, and the camo benefits and never regretted it or felt like there was something better I could be using. I probably won’t be using it this season, but that’s because over half my mythics are restricted and void just barely missed the cut.
After using eclipse, voidress usually has at least one good target. This could be any of the very common humanoid targets, a DR mon, or even your own teammates at 25tu no less. When voidress does have these targets, your opponent must find a way to deal with it soon or they’ll likely face major consequences.
(edit: I forgot to mention you only need to have targets once or twice before you can use bloodbath. Bloodbath one shots a lot of shadow mons after two kills.)
If you are in a situation where you don’t have any targets, which I do feel is less likely than a lot of people think it is, you can always kill it off with ritual VI. For me, I feel like it’s necessary for voidress to kill itself at most 5% of the time.

It can be front line but also anywhere early-game works fine. You’re correct it lacks aggression, which is why you need plenty of aggressive monsters around it. Glaciaron and Padrinorca are not what you want to run with it because they have low TU moves and are not beasts. Shikabloom is a more classic example.
170TU frozen wave+ doesn’t sound great, but many times I have this enter from reinforcements then do instant purifying mist and stealthy accelerate itself to do 85TU instead.
